Don't worry about the new3DS / old3DS Buttons. (They are insert preset IPs from a config file)
The black part on the buttom is like the Console output for Houston.
Files are removed from the List after installing. Therefore you can always see how many files are left to go and which file is currently Installing (top one)
The Progress Bar shows the Progress and the number above it shows how many out of how many files have been installed successfully.
The C# Port doesn't require the cygwin1.dll and is 17KB in size instead of 70KB (houston size)
